Oddělte e-mailové adresy od uživatelských jmen a domén v aplikaci Excel
Obvykle se e-mailová adresa skládá z uživatelského jména, symbolu @ a názvu domény, ale někdy budete možná muset rozdělit e-mailovou adresu na samostatné uživatelské jméno a název domény, jak je uvedeno níže, tento článek, představím některé vzorce pro rozdělení e-mailové adresy v aplikaci Excel.
E-mailové adresy oddělte od uživatelských jmen a názvů domén pomocí vzorců
Extrahujte uživatelská jména z e-mailových adres:
V aplikaci Excel vám funkce LEFT a FIND pomohou extrahovat uživatelská jména, obecná syntaxe je:
- email: E-mailová adresa nebo buňka obsahuje e-mailovou adresu, kterou chcete rozdělit.
Zkopírujte nebo zadejte následující vzorec do prázdné buňky, kde chcete získat výsledek:
A pak přetáhněte popisovač výplně dolů do dalších buněk, kterými chcete tento vzorec vyplnit, a všechna uživatelská jména byla extrahována, jak je uvedeno níže:
Vysvětlení vzorce:
Najít ("@", A2) -1: Funkce FIND vrátí pozici znaku @ v buňce A2 a odečtení 1 znamená vyloučení znaku @. A získá výsledek: 10.
LEFT(A2,FIND("@",A2)-1)=LEFT(A2, 10): Funkce LEFT extrahuje 10 znaků z levé strany buňky A2.
Extrahujte názvy domén z e-mailových adres:
Chcete-li extrahovat názvy domén, funkce RIGHT, LEN a FIND vám udělají laskavost, obecná syntaxe je:
- email: E-mailová adresa nebo buňka obsahuje e-mailovou adresu, kterou chcete rozdělit.
Použijte následující vzorec do prázdné buňky:
A pak přetáhněte popisovač výplně dolů do buněk, na které chcete použít tento vzorec, a všechny názvy domén byly extrahovány najednou, viz screenshot:
Vysvětlení vzorce:
Najít ("@", A2): Funkce FIND vrátí pozici znaku @ v buňce A2 a získá výsledek: 11.
DÉLKA (A2):Tato funkce LEN se používá k získání počtu znaků v buňce A2. Získá číslo 20.
LEN (A2) -FIND ("@", A2) = 20-11: Odečtěte pozici znaku @ od celkové délky textového řetězce v buňce A2 a získejte počet znaků za znakem @. Tento vzorec součásti je rozpoznán jako argument num_chars funkce RIGHT.
RIGHT(A2,LEN(A2)-FIND("@",A2))=RIGHT(A2, 9): Nakonec se tato PRAVÁ funkce používá k extrakci 9 znaků z pravé strany buňky A2.
Použité relativní funkce:
- LEFT:
- Funkce LEFT extrahuje daný počet znaků z levé strany zadaného řetězce.
- RIGHT:
- Funkce RIGHT se používá k extrakci konkrétního počtu znaků z pravé strany textového řetězce.
- FIND:
- Funkce FIND se používá k vyhledání řetězce v jiném řetězci a vrací počáteční pozici řetězce uvnitř jiného.
- LEN:
- Funkce LEN vrací počet znaků v textovém řetězci.
Další články:
- Oddělte oktety IP adresy v aplikaci Excel
- Zkoušeli jste někdy rozdělit adresy IP do samostatných sloupců v listu aplikace Excel? Možná vám funkce Text na sloupec pomůže rychle vyřešit tuto práci, ale v tomto článku budu hovořit o některých vzorcích pro dosažení tohoto úkolu v aplikaci Excel.
- Rozdělte text a čísla do buňky v aplikaci Excel
- Předpokládejme, že data buňky jsou smíchána s textem a čísly, jak je můžete rozdělit do samostatných buněk sloupců? V tomto výukovém programu vám ukážeme podrobné kroky, jak to vyřešit pomocí vzorců.
- Rozdělte kóty na dvě části v aplikaci Excel
- Tento článek vysvětluje, jak použít vzorec k rozdělení dimenzí v buňce na dvě části bez jednotek (jednotlivé délky a šířky).
- Rozdělte rozměry na jednotlivé délky, výšky a šířky
- Tento článek vysvětluje, jak rozdělit rozměry v buňce na tři části (jednotlivé rozměry, které zahrnují délku, výšku a šířku).
Nejlepší kancelářské nástroje produktivity
Kutools pro Excel - pomůže vám vyniknout před davem
Kutools pro Excel se může pochlubit více než 300 funkcemi, Zajištění toho, že to, co potřebujete, je jen jedno kliknutí...
Záložka Office - Povolte čtení a úpravy na záložkách v Microsoft Office (včetně Excelu)
- Jednu sekundu přepnete mezi desítkami otevřených dokumentů!
- Snižte stovky kliknutí myší každý den, sbohem s myší rukou.
- Zvyšuje vaši produktivitu o 50% při prohlížení a úpravách více dokumentů.
- Přináší efektivní karty do Office (včetně Excelu), stejně jako Chrome, Edge a Firefox.